Natarajan's mortal remains laid to rest

Press Trust of India  |  Thanjavur (TN) 

The body of M Natarajan, husband of jailed VK Sasikala, was buried near here today after a large number of people paid their last respects.

The body of 74-year-old was taken in a procession from his house here before it was buried at Mullaivaikkal Muttram premises, a few km away.

Those who attended the final rites included Sasikala's nephew TTV and her brother

The body was brought here last night from Chennai, where he died yesterday, three days after he was admitted to a hospital there with a severe chest infection.

Sasikala, who was granted parole for 15 days by the Bengaluru prison authorities to attend the funeral, also reached here last night.

She is serving a four year jail term in the Parappana Agrahara prison in connection with the Rs 66.6 crore disproportionate assets case.

Scores of political leaders paid homage to in Chennai and here since yesterday.

His body was initially kept in Chennai before being brought here.
